
UK - Bank of Scotland Corporate backs APA Parafricta
Bank of Scotland Corporate’s Growth Capital team has invested £115,000 into APA Parafricta Ltd, a developer of low-friction products for the medical sector, as part of a £230,000 funding round.
Garments and bedding made from APA Parafricta's unique ultra low-friction fabric are used to protect patient skin when there is a risk of damage to highly sensitive areas, resulting in bedsores or pressure ulcers. Expenditure by the NHS in the UK on treatment of bedsores alone exceeds £2.1bn every year.
The Co-Investment Programme was launched by OION and Bank of Scotland Corporate’s Growth Capital team in early 2008. Through the £2m scheme, the Bank will match funds from OION investors in innovative technology companies.
